CGI's Advantage Cloud Operations is an SRE-driven operating model, anchored on an Operations Control Plane that unifies telemetry, event management, automation, and IT Service Management (ITSM). The Operations Analyst is a hands-on Site Reliability Engineering (SRE) practitioner responsible for monitoring, triaging, and resolving incidents using correlated telemetry and automated runbooks. This role contributes to reducing operational toil through automation and disciplined problem management while supporting the reliability of CGI's Advantage platform.

Your future duties and responsibilities:

Operations & Reliability
• Serve in a hands-on operations role (SRE track) within the Cloud Operations team supporting the CGI Advantage platform.
• Take first-line ownership of monitoring, event triage, incident handling, and service request execution.
• Work from the operator portal utilizing correlated dashboards, one-click runbooks, and standardized operational workflows.
• Contribute to automation, ticket hygiene, and knowledge base quality to reduce repeat work.
• Progress toward the Senior Operations Analyst role through the SRE realignment career path.

Monitoring & Event Triage
• Monitor environment health using standardized dashboards and SLO-aligned alerts.
• Triage events in IAP by applying deduplication and suppression context while routing incidents according to severity taxonomy.
• Utilize distributed traces and correlated logs and metrics to isolate faults before escalation.
• Meet First Touch Resolution and L1-to-L2 escalation reduction targets.

Incident & Service Request Execution
• Execute approved runbooks and guard-railed self-service actions, including diagnostics, restarts, and environment tasks.
• Maintain complete, well-classified tickets using guided intake fields and consistent operational taxonomy.
• Coordinate activities within automatically created Microsoft Teams incident channels while documenting timelines and handoffs.
• Draft clear customer-facing status updates using standardized communication templates.

Continuous Improvement
• Identify recurring incidents as problem management candidates and support Root Cause Analysis (RCA) efforts with evidence and operational data.
• Develop small automation scripts using Python, Bash, or PowerShell and recommend new runbook candidates based on recurring operational tasks.
• Report configuration drift and validate changes against approved baselines under change control.
• Maintain runbooks and knowledge articles while leveraging LLM-assisted triage tools to improve operational efficiency.

Required qualifications to be successful in this role:
• 2-5 years of experience in cloud or application operations, Network Operations Center (NOC), or L1/L2 production support environments.
• Working knowledge of Microsoft Azure and Kubernetes (AKS), including: Pods ,Deployments ,Logging ,Scaling concepts
• Experience with monitoring and logging platforms, including: Grafana-style dashboards ,Log search and analytics ,Alert management
• Basic scripting experience using: Bash,Python ,PowerShell
• Knowledge of IT Service Management (ITSM), including: Incident Management ,Service Request Lifecycle ,SLA awareness ,Quality ticket documentation
• Linux fundamentals
• Networking fundamentals, including: DNS ,TLS ,Load balancing
• Experience using Git
• Strong written and verbal communication skills for incident updates and operational handoffs.

Preferred Experience
. OpenTelemetry, Jaeger tracing, or Prometheus/Loki exposure.
. Ansible playbooks, Terraform basics, or GitHub Actions pipelines.
. Event management/AIOps platforms and runbook automation tools.
. PostgreSQL basics and SQL for operational queries and diagnostics.
. Certifications: AZ 900/AZ 104, CKA (entry), ITIL 4 Foundation.
